Step 1
Preheat oven to 400°F. Coat a rimmed baking sheet with cooking spray.
Step 2
Combine lemon zest, almonds, dill, 1 Tbsp oil, 1/2 tsp salt and pepper in a small bowl. Place fish on the prepared baking sheet and spread each portion with 1 tsp mustard. Divide the almond mixture among the portions, pressing it onto the mustard.
Step 3
Bake the fish until opaque in the center, about 7 to 9 minutes, depending on thickness.
Step 4
Meanwhile, heat the remaining 2 tsp oil in a Dutch oven over medium heat. Add garlic and cook, stirring, until fragrant but not brown, about 30 seconds. Stir in spinach, lemon juice and the remaining 1/2 tsp salt; season with pepper. Cook, stirring often, until the spinach is just wilted, 2 to 4 minutes. Cover to keep warm. Serve the fish with the spinach and lemon wedges, if desired.
